Optimum Investment Advisors

Call
111 Anza Blvd Ste 212
Burlingame, CA 94010

Optimum Investment Advisors, located in Burlingame, CA, is a financial service specializing in providing expert advice and guidance to clients.

With a focus on maximizing investment returns and optimizing financial portfolios, Optimum Investment Advisors is dedicated to helping individuals and businesses achieve their financial goals.

Generated from their available business information

Own this business?
See a problem?

You might also like

United StatesCaliforniaBurlingameOptimum Investment Advisors

Partial Data by Foursquare.